Home Automation can be something as simple as remote or automatic control of a few lights, all the way to control of security, cameras, home theater (audio), HVAC or any electronic device around your home or business.

Adding home automation into an existing home or business is surprisingly affordable and simple to control with todays technology of smart phones, iPads, even an iPod touch.

Phone Systems

Phone systems which are usually used for small business applications are surprisingly convenient in the home. With the many features they have, voice mail can be added and checked from anywhere in the world anytime via the phone. You can even have the system call you in an event.

Thermostats

Remote control thermostats allow you to adjust the temperature from bed at night or even from a cell phone while on your way home (or to your 2nd home!). They can even trigger a notice to you if the temperature gets too low (freezing pipes) or too high (pets, plants, etc.).

Networking

Home automation can be accomplished using various types of connectivity. What's great is that many of today's home automation products need no new wiring - so they are perfect to retrofit into an existing home. If you are building new, or doing a major remodel, please consider adding networking, audio, video and control wiring while it is easy and relatively inexpensive, later on you'll be happy you did.
